Comics, Movies & Games: How Different Eras Shape Tattoo Styles
From his first appearance in Detective Comics #27 in 1939 to the blockbuster films of today, Batman’s look has constantly changed. This evolution has given tattoo lovers plenty of inspiration:
- Golden & Silver Age Comics: Bold, vibrant tattoos with classic Batman colors (blue, gray, and yellow), often featuring speech bubbles or action-packed panels.
- Dark Knight Era (1980s- Present): Inspired by Frank Miller’s The Dark Knight Returns, these tattoos have a darker, grittier aesthetic, sometimes incorporating shadow-heavy art or Batman in his modern black suit.
- Video Game Influence: The Arkham series has brought hyper-realistic and cinematic Batman designs to life, inspiring tattoos with detailed textures, battle-worn suits, and intense expressions.
Christopher Nolan vs. Tim Burton Aesthetic: Dark Realism vs. Gothic Vibes
Two of the most influential Batman directors, Tim Burton and Christopher Nolan, have created visually distinct versions of Gotham’s protector, leading to very different tattoo styles:
- Tim Burton-Inspired Tattoos: Known for his gothic and surreal take on Batman, Burton’s aesthetic lends itself to dark, eerie tattoos, often featuring Danny Elfman’s Bat-Signal, eerie lighting, or stylized versions of characters like The Penguin, Bugs Bunny Tattoos or Catwoman tattoos.
- Christopher Nolan-Inspired Tattoos: Nolan’s realistic and gritty Dark Knight trilogy has inspired highly detailed, shadow-heavy designs, including Christian Bale’s Batman, Heath Ledger’s Joker, or the ominous crumbling Bat-Symbol from The Dark Knight Rises.
If you love a dramatic, comic-book fantasy look, Burton-inspired ink is perfect. If you prefer hyper-realistic, intense tattoos, Nolan’s version is the way to go.

Black & Grey vs. Color Tattoos: Choosing the Right Aesthetic
When getting a Batman tattoo, one big decision is black & grey vs. color. Each choice creates a different mood:
- Black & grey tattoos are moody, dramatic, and highly detailed, making them perfect for dark, shadowy Batman designs.
- Color tattoos bring vibrancy and energy, ideal for comic-inspired designs, Joker tattoos, or Gotham’s neon lights.
- Some designs mix both—like a black & grey Batman with a bright red Joker smile in the background for a striking contrast.
If you want a gritty, noir-inspired look, black & grey is a classic choice. If you want bold comic book energy, go for color.

Tattoo Aftercare Tips: Keeping Your Ink Vibrant for Years
Once your tattoo is done, proper aftercare is key to keeping it bold and vibrant:
- Keep it clean: Wash gently with unscented soap to avoid irritation.
- Moisturize regularly: Apply a tattoo-safe lotion to prevent dryness and fading.
- Avoid direct sunlight: UV rays can cause colors to fade, so use sunscreen once your tattoo is healed.
- Follow your artist’s advice: Every artist has their aftercare recommendations, so listen to their instructions carefully.
With the right care, your Batman tattoo will stay sharp and detailed for years to come.
